ruby-changes:42831
From: ktsj <ko1@a...>
Date: Wed, 4 May 2016 17:50:07 +0900 (JST)
Subject: [ruby-changes:42831] ktsj:r54905 (trunk): * test/net/http/test_httpheader.rb: add missing test of
ktsj 2016-05-04 18:46:43 +0900 (Wed, 04 May 2016) New Revision: 54905 https://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=revision&revision=54905 Log: * test/net/http/test_httpheader.rb: add missing test of Net::HTTPHeader#each_capitalized_name. Modified files: trunk/test/net/http/test_httpheader.rb Index: test/net/http/test_httpheader.rb =================================================================== --- test/net/http/test_httpheader.rb (revision 54904) +++ test/net/http/test_httpheader.rb (revision 54905) @@ -121,6 +121,15 @@ class HTTPHeaderTest < Test::Unit::TestC https://github.com/ruby/ruby/blob/trunk/test/net/http/test_httpheader.rb#L121 @c.each_key do |k| assert_equal 'my-header', k end + + def test_each_capitalized_name + @c['my-header'] = 'test' + @c.each_capitalized_name do |k| + assert_equal 'My-Header', k + end + @c.each_capitalized_name do |k| + assert_equal 'My-Header', k + end end def test_each_value -- ML: ruby-changes@q... Info: http://www.atdot.net/~ko1/quickml/